1. Limitations and Challenges of Traditional Safety Insoles
In industrial safety footwear, steel plates are commonly embedded in the sole to protect workers from punctures and heavy impacts. While effective for safety, this design creates numerous issues:
Heavy and tiring: Steel plates significantly increase shoe weight, causing foot fatigue and discomfort during prolonged standing or walking, reducing work efficiency.
Poor comfort and breathability: Steel plates are rigid and lack cushioning, causing uneven pressure and sweaty feet prone to odor and infections.
Safety risks: To reduce fatigue, some workers switch to lighter shoes without proper protection, increasing risk of injury.
High maintenance and replacement costs: Steel plates deform over time, reducing protection and requiring frequent replacement, increasing costs for employers.
These pain points have driven the footwear industry to seek lightweight alternatives that maintain safety and comfort.
2. Unique Advantages of Carbon Fiber Insoles
1. Extreme Lightness to Reduce Fatigue
Insoles made from carbon fiber mat are incredibly lightweight, significantly reducing the shoe's overall weight and easing fatigue during long working hours.
2. Outstanding Mechanical Strength and Toughness
Carbon fiber offers high tensile and compressive strength, effectively dispersing foot pressure and protecting against punctures and impacts.
3. Excellent Shape Memory and Durability
The insole maintains its shape and support over time, minimizing fatigue and injury caused by worn-out insoles.
4. Great Shock Absorption and Resilience
The composite structure provides rigidity with slight elasticity, absorbing impact forces to reduce strain on knees and lower back.
5. Superior Moisture Resistance and Antimicrobial Properties
The dense fiber weave and resin matrix prevent sweat penetration, inhibiting bacteria growth and keeping feet fresh and healthy.

4. Expanding Applications Across Industries
Industrial Safety Shoes: Reduce worker fatigue while ensuring protection.
Sports Footwear: Provide lightweight, supportive cushioning for high-impact activities.
Medical and Rehabilitation Shoes: Aid foot correction and pain relief.
Outdoor and Hiking Boots: Combine protection with lightweight comfort on rugged terrain.
Fashion and Casual Shoes: Improve all-day comfort for everyday wear.
